Output c18f4db905a47ada314785d4ac6e4e88d864982ecbe8b9d123ef540aa7b7db3c:1

value
52663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374d2b87898a13b91cddfb5eede6adf1f1a7a OP_EQUAL
address
3BMEXL36ZVG4qNhxgyEE7QQ2CBEMkiyvwE
transaction
c18f4db905a47ada314785d4ac6e4e88d864982ecbe8b9d123ef540aa7b7db3c
confirmations
344707
spent
true